They are very similar to ezgo. The 252 is like a marathon. I have not found a source for lifts so its on you to make one. Vintage is your best source. I went to a local shop for bearings. If i remember correctly the motor is 19 spline like a yamaha. I still have my 512e and for sale locally. Everything else though is upgradable(is that a word) :).

It's a polish copy of the Ezgo. In and out of production since the late 60's . Some Ezgo parts fit and some do not. My first cart was a Melex
